Título: Python script para archivos bin Publicado por: samsaga2 en 15 de Febrero de 2011, 10:36:44 am Este script en python lo utilizo para volcar archivos binarios (tipo bsave) de pantallas de screen 5 a c o ensamblador. También puedes extraer fácilmente la paleta de pantallazos en screen 5 o tiles del screen 2.
Espero que le sea útil a alguien más. Ejemplo: Para extraer la paleta de colores de una pantalla screen 5: Código: python bsave.py -i pantallazo.sc5 -o pantallazo.asm -s 0x7680 -z 32 -v -f asm Obtenemos: Código: db 11h,01h,00h,00h,14h,02h,17h,04h,12h,02h db 52h,01h,44h,04h,21h,02h,21h,04h,41h,05h db 41h,03h,64h,03h,73h,06h,56h,06h,61h,04h db 77h,07h Código: import sys import getopt def read(input, start, size, verbose): bytes = input.read() if bytes[0] != 0xfe: print("Unknown input file format") sys.exit(1) header_start = bytes[2] * 256 + bytes[1] header_stop = bytes[4] * 256 + bytes[3] header_run = bytes[6] * 256 + bytes[5] if verbose: print("""Header: Start: %s Stop: %s Run: %s""" % (hex(header_start), hex(header_stop), hex(header_run))) if start != None: offset = start - header_start + 7 if offset < 0: print("Start addres out of bounds") sys.exit(1) else: offset = 0 if verbose: print("File offset %x" % (offset)) if size == None: size = len(bytes) output_bytes = [] for i in range(0, size): output_bytes.append(bytes[offset + i]) return output_bytes def dump_bin(output, bytes): with open(output, "w") as o: for x in bytes: o.write(chr(x)) def dump_asm(output, bytes): with open(output, "w") as o: bytes = ["%02Xh" % i for i in bytes] for x in range(0, len(bytes), 10): o.write("\tdb ") o.write(",".join(bytes[x:][:10])) o.write("\n") def dump_c(output, bytes): with open(output, "w") as o: bytes = ["0x%02X" % i for i in bytes] o.write("const unsigned char bytes[] = {\n") for x in range(0, len(bytes), 10): o.write("\t" + ",".join(bytes[x:][:10])) if x+10 <= len(bytes): o.write(",") o.write("\n") o.write("\n}") def dump_none(output, bytes): with open(output, "w") as o: bytes = ["%02X" % i for i in bytes] for x in range(0, len(bytes), 10): o.write(" ".join(bytes[x:][:10])) o.write("\n") def usage(): print("""bsave.py [options]) Options: -h --help Show help -s offset --start offset Start address of dump -z bytes --size bytes Number of bytes to dump -i filename --input filename Input filename -o filename --output filename Output filename -v --verbose Verbose -f type --format type Output type format Output type formats: bin Binary output c C format asm ASM format none Text output """) def main(argv): input = None output = None start_offset = None size = None verbose = False format = "none" try: opts, args = getopt.getopt(argv, "hs:z:i:o:vf:", ["help", "start", "size", "input", "output", "verbose", "format"]) except getopt.GetoptError: usage() sys.exit(2) for opt, arg in opts: if opt in ("-h", "--help"): usage() sys.exit() elif opt in ("-s", "--start"): if arg[:2] == '0x': start_offset = int(arg[2:], 16) else: start_offset = int(arg) elif opt in ("-z", "--size"): if arg[:2] == '0x': size = int(arg[2:], 16) else: size = int(arg) elif opt in ("-i", "--input"): input = arg elif opt in ("-o", "--output"): output = arg elif opt in ("-v", "--verbose"): verbose = True elif opt in ("-f", "--format"): format = arg if input == None: print("Missing input file") usage() sys.exit(3) if output == None: print("Missing output file") usage() sys.exit(4) # get bytes with open(input, "rb") as i: bytes = read(i, start_offset, size, verbose) # write bytes if format == "bin": dump_bin(output, bytes) else: if format == "none": dump_none(output, bytes) elif format == "c": dump_c(output, bytes) elif format == "asm": dump_asm(output, bytes) if __name__ == '__main__': main(sys.argv[1:]) |
